In a small bowl, mix the softened butter and garlic powder until combined.
Spread the garlic butter evenly on one side of each slice of bread. The buttered side will be the outside of the jaffle.
In another bowl, mix the shredded chicken with the marinara sauce until well coated.
Place a slice of bread, buttered side down, on your jaffle maker or sandwich press.
Layer the bread with half of the shredded chicken, 1/4 cup of mozzarella cheese, 1 tablespoon of Parmesan cheese, and 1 basil leaf (if using).
Top with the second slice of bread, buttered side up, to complete the sandwich.
Close your jaffle maker or sandwich press and cook for 3-5 minutes, or until the bread is golden brown and crispy, and the cheese is melted.
Carefully remove the jaffle and let it cool slightly before slicing it in half.
Repeat the process for the second jaffle. Serve immediately and enjoy.
